Output 58ab28d9f4698ccbcd24df1feafacd176cbd889dfbaaca185ed0d212a1eff53b:1

value
21650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4675b0ad1372f60e918dfa909870a5f47c702b4 OP_EQUALVERIFY OP_CHECKSIG
address
1JuVFshTWfEeehXmuKEniseCS2e9zVomS5
transaction
58ab28d9f4698ccbcd24df1feafacd176cbd889dfbaaca185ed0d212a1eff53b
spent
true